A sizable proportion of sterile items are produced by aseptic processing. Since aseptic processing relies within the exclusion of microorganisms from the process stream as well as avoidance of microorganisms from entering open containers for the duration of filling, products bioburden together with microbial bioburden of the production surroundings are important variables concerning the level of sterility assurance of such products.
Basic mycological media, for instance Sabouraud's, Modified Sabouraud's, or Inhibitory Mould Agar are appropriate. Other media which have been validated for selling the growth of fungi, for instance Soybean–Casein Digest Agar, can be utilized. On the whole, screening for obligatory anaerobes is just not done routinely. However, need to disorders or investigations warrant, like the identification of these organisms in sterility testing facilities, much more Recurrent screening is indicated. The flexibility of the selected media to detect and quantitate these anaerobes or microaerophilic microorganisms really should be evaluated.

The swabbing method might be utilized for sampling of irregular surfaces, especially for devices. Swabbing is utilized to complement Call plates for regular surfaces. The swab is then placed in an suitable diluent but shouldn't hold for long period of time plus the estimate of microbial depend is finished by plating of an proper aliquot on or in specified nutrient agar.

Isolator programs need relatively infrequent microbiological monitoring. Ongoing complete particulate monitoring can provide assurance the air filtration technique inside the isolator is working thoroughly. The approaches for quantitative microbiological air sampling explained In this particular chapter might not have enough sensitivity to check the setting inside of an isolator.
